在数字化转型的大潮中,数据库作为核心组件,其重要性不言而喻。然而,面对众多的数据库产品,如何选择适合自己的呢?尤其是对于初学者来说,阿里云数据库支持哪些SQL语言类型?这可能是你最关心的问题之一。别担心,这篇文章将手把手教你正确姿势,带你深入了解阿里云数据库的SQL语言类型,解决你的技术难题,让你在数据库管理的路上不再迷茫。
一、阿里云数据库概览,带你快速入门首先,让我们来了解一下阿里云数据库的基本情况。 阿里云数据库是阿里巴巴集团旗下的云计算品牌——阿里云提供的数据库服务,它包括多种类型的数据库产品,如关系型数据库RDS、NoSQL数据库、图数据库等。每种数据库产品都针对不同的应用场景进行了优化,满足不同用户的多样化需求。
对于大多数开发者而言,关系型数据库RDS是最常用的一种数据库服务。阿里云RDS支持多种主流的SQL语言,包括MySQL、PostgreSQL、SQL Server等,这意味着你可以根据自己的业务需求和技术背景选择合适的SQL语言。
二、阿里云数据库支持的SQL语言类型,一目了然那么,具体来说,阿里云数据库支持哪些SQL语言类型呢?下面我们来详细了解一下。
1. MySQL:
MySQL是目前最流行的开源关系型数据库管理系统之一,以其高性能、高可靠性和易于使用的特点著称。阿里云RDS for MySQL完全兼容MySQL语法,支持各种复杂的查询操作,适用于Web应用、在线交易处理等多种场景。
2. PostgreSQL:
PostgreSQL是一种功能强大的开源对象关系型数据库系统,支持复杂的查询、外键、触发器、视图等功能。阿里云RDS for PostgreSQL同样支持标准的SQL语言,同时还提供了一些高级特性,如JSONB支持、全文搜索等,非常适合复杂的数据处理任务。
3. SQL Server:
SQL Server是由微软开发的关系型数据库管理系统,广泛应用于企业级应用中。阿里云RDS for SQL Server支持T-SQL语言,提供了丰富的数据管理和分析工具,适用于需要高度集成和安全性的企业环境。
除了上述几种常见的SQL语言,阿里云还支持其他类型的数据库,如Oracle、PPAS等,满足不同用户的需求。
三、如何选择适合自己的SQL语言类型?了解了阿里云数据库支持的SQL语言类型后,你可能会问,如何选择最适合自己的那一种呢? 下面是一些建议,希望能帮助你做出更好的决策。
1. 考虑业务需求:
不同的业务场景对数据库的需求不同。例如,如果你的应用主要涉及简单的数据存储和检索,那么MySQL可能是一个不错的选择;如果你的应用需要处理复杂的数据分析任务,那么PostgreSQL或SQL Server可能更适合你。
2. 技术背景和团队熟悉度:
选择数据库时,还需要考虑团队的技术背景和熟悉程度。如果你的团队已经熟悉某种SQL语言,那么继续使用这种语言可以减少学习成本,提高开发效率。
3. 成本和预算:
不同的数据库产品在价格上有所差异。在选择时,你需要根据自己的预算来权衡。阿里云提供了灵活的计费模式,可以根据实际使用量进行付费,有助于控制成本。
4. 社区支持和生态:
良好的社区支持和丰富的生态系统可以为你的开发工作带来便利。例如,MySQL拥有庞大的开发者社区,可以轻松找到解决问题的方法;而SQL Server则有强大的企业级支持和服务。
除了支持多种SQL语言类型,阿里云数据库还具有一些高级特性和优势,可以帮助你在数据管理和应用开发中更加高效。
1. 高可用性和灾备方案:
阿里云数据库提供了多种高可用性和灾备方案,确保数据的安全性和可靠性。例如,RDS支持主备架构,自动备份和恢复功能,可以有效防止数据丢失。️
2. 弹性和扩展性:
随着业务的发展,数据量可能会快速增长。阿里云数据库支持弹性伸缩,可以根据实际需求动态调整资源,保证系统的稳定运行。
3. 安全性和合规性:
数据安全是每个企业都非常关注的问题。阿里云数据库提供了多种安全措施,如SSL加密、VPC网络隔离等,确保数据传输和存储的安全。
4. 丰富的管理工具和API:
阿里云提供了丰富的数据库管理工具和API,帮助你轻松管理和监控数据库。无论是日常运维还是故障排查,都能得心应手。️
通过本文的介绍,相信你对阿里云数据库支持的SQL语言类型有了更深入的了解。无论是MySQL、PostgreSQL还是SQL Server,阿里云都提供了强大的支持和丰富的特性,帮助你在数据管理和应用开发中更加高效。
如果你还有任何疑问或需要进一步的帮助,欢迎随时留言交流。期待与你一起探索更多关于阿里云数据库的知识,共同成长!
2025-05-04 15:19:20
2025-05-04 15:19:13
2025-05-04 15:19:10
2025-05-04 15:19:07
2025-05-04 15:19:04